I'm using a Samsung tft with a max resolution of 1024x768 and is 15". When I set a higher resolution, like 1280x1024 it still displays a picture. Does this damage the monitor? Y does this not support 1280x1024 even though it works?
1024x768 will be the monitor's native resolution, any resolution bigger and the monitor will interporlate. This will be most noticable with small text - it will become distorted. It wont damage it in anyway, but you'll be better off sticking to the native resolution.
